We also tried out something from the lunch menu:
- Wagyu steak sandwich, with leaves, beetroot relish, pickles and horseradish yoghurt
I was told this dish would change my life and this comment wasn’t far from the truth- I have often thought about this burger since eating it.
This is not your ordinary steak sandwich. This is one of the best steak sandwiches you'll find in Brisbane.
The generous serve of wagyu was cooked perfectly, with a nice pink inside. The thoughtful thin slices of meat also made eating this burger nice and easy.
I loved the creamy horseradish yoghurt as well, adding a spicy tang to the burger, which was served up on a crispy black brioche bun.
